Handing off on-call for the Quillstone markdown pipeline. Open items: renderer pods restarted twice overnight, suspect the table-parsing patch merged Friday. Rollback branch is staged but not deployed. Sanitizer allowlist change still pending review — please prioritize, it blocks the footnote fix. Dashboards are green otherwise. Runbook updated with the new restart steps. Questions during the transition should go to me at the address below.

escalation mailbox, bafog-fafog: ulador@paliqlabs.internal

Ticket: cron drift on Ostermill schedulers. New folks: we found three nodes where cron schedules diverged from the Ansible-managed baseline — someone hand-edited crontabs during the March incident and never reverted. Symptoms: duplicate nightly exports, missed cache warmups. Fix is to re-run the config sync and lock the crontabs. Do not edit schedules on-box; change the repo instead. The baseline values the nodes should converge to are listed below.

config for tawif-bagef:
[sorwyn]
team = sorys
access_code = ac_9ba40c
host = sorwyn.ordingrid.local
port = 5000
owner = aldok.quenion
peer = belath.paliqcloud.local

**Alert: Sandbox bypass in Brindlekit large-file diff viewer**

The diff viewer skips content sanitization for files over 8 MB, rendering raw markup in the review pane. A crafted file could execute script in a reviewer's session. Severity is high; a patch is staged. Reproduction steps and the proposed fix are documented here:

operations page: https://jenkins.zemvarcloud.local/job/merge_requests/repo/build/73930b4b30f0a8ed

**Vendor Note: Dependency Pinning for Quillbranch Plugins**

All third-party plugins submitted to the Quillbranch marketplace must pin direct dependencies to exact versions. Ranged specifiers (caret, tilde, or wildcard) will fail automated review, as they have repeatedly caused resolution drift in our nightly compatibility builds. Transitive dependencies should be locked via a committed lockfile. If your build tooling cannot produce one, request an exemption from our vendor review desk before submission.

pager mailbox: quenael@zemvarsys.internal